Admin, hope I’m okay to post.

So a while back I recorded an EP called Social Distance.

It’s largely inspired by my Dad’s severe covid illness (see my old posts) and many of the stories relayed on here.

Anyhow, it’s on Spotify- search for Raggy Gold -Social Distance open.spotify.com/album/3jZt...

I hope many of you can relate to it and it offers some comfort.

The lead single Abbie was about a nurse that I used to get updates from on the phone-I’ve never met the nurse, but always gained comfort from our conversations and her positivity in those darkest days of gloom. Indeed, hope is all we have when our loved ones our in ICU, strapped up to a ventilator. Stay positive and stay blessed 🙏🏾✌🏾
